Output 324187ea77d35631b2992a07f5d1c7b6273eedb94f68285b6e3c0ad906124995:1

value
394860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e1ea3d24da14b01b81b6d4322c3f0a87c07998 OP_EQUAL
address
32QhHjcwHm987yR8HpfU1LE1nBfsk9SWBv
transaction
324187ea77d35631b2992a07f5d1c7b6273eedb94f68285b6e3c0ad906124995
spent
true